Software Engineer(AFLCMC/ESAW)

Apogee Engineering, LLC - Offutt AFB, NE

Apply Now

Job Description

Apogee is seeking a Software Engineer, Senior to be located in Omaha, NE, may allow for a hybrid schedule in support of the Air Force Life Cycle Management Center (AFLCMC) Weather Systems Branch (AFLCMC/ESAW) . This position will provide Software Engineering and Development support to the Numerical Weather Models (NWM) program directly working with 557 Weather Wing (557 WW) software development teams to design, develop, and maintain secure software solutions, integrate DevSecOps practices, and ensure security and compliance throughout the Software Development Life Cycle while collaborating with agile teams to deliver high-quality, secure software. This role offers the opportunity to make a significant impact on critical national defense systems while working with cutting-edge DevSecOps technologies in a collaborative, mission-focused operational environment.DevSecOps & Software DevelopmentDesign, develop, and maintain secure software solutions within an agile development frameworkImplement DevSecOps practices including automated security testing, code scanning, and vulnerability assessment throughout the CI/CD pipelineCollaborate with cross-functional agile teams to translate high-level requirements into detailed technical designs and user storiesDevelop and maintain automated build, test, deployment, and infrastructure provisioning scriptsConduct peer code reviews and security assessments to ensure adherence to secure coding practicesSecurity & ComplianceIntegrate security controls and compliance requirements into the Software Development Lifecycle (SDLC)Perform Software Quality Assurance (SQA) to ensure developed software meets defined security and quality specificationsAnalyze and remediate security vulnerabilities identified through automated scanning and manual testingMaintain documentation for security controls, compliance artifacts, and risk assessmentsTechnical EngineeringApply advanced software engineering principles to analyze requirements, design solutions, and evaluate operational feasibilityDevelop comprehensive technical documentation including architecture diagrams, flowcharts, and system specificationsConduct systems analysis and recommend process improvements for enhanced security and operational efficiencyEvaluate, test, and recommend software tools and technologies that support secure development practicesAgile Team CollaborationActively participate in agile ceremonies including sprint planning, daily standups, retrospectives, and sprint reviewsCollaborate with government lead engineers, users, and stakeholders to refine requirements and deliver value iterativelyContribute to continuous improvement of team processes and DevSecOps practicesMinimum Experience:Citizenship: Must be a US citizenClearance: Must possess and maintain a TS w/SCI eligibilityCertifications: Current CSSLP or equivalent certification required. Security+ or equivalent certification with 6 months to obtain CSSLP acceptableEducation combined with years of Experience:Advanced Degree (MA/MS) with 10+ years of relevant experience (12+years preferred), including minimum of 5 years supporting the DoDOR, BA/BS with 12+ years of relevant experience (15+years preferred), including minimum of 5 years supporting the DoDOR, 18+ years of relevant experience (20+years preferred) with minimum of 8 years supporting the DoD (in lieu of a degree)Current CSSLP or equivalent certification required. Security+ or equivalent certification with 6 months to obtain CSSLP acceptable Extensive knowledge and hands-on experience across the complete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C)Strong software design and coding expertise with secure development practices. Expertise with Python required.Comprehensive understanding of agile methodologies (Scrum, Kanban, SAFe)Proficiency in DevSecOps tools and practices including CI/CD pipelines, automated testing, and security integration. Experience with Gitlab, preferredExperience with infrastructure as code, containerization, and cloud security practices Domain Expertise Proven experience supporting Department of Defense software development projects Understanding of government compliance requirements and security frameworks Experience working in classified environments and handling sensitive information**This position requires an on-call schedule once every 6 weeks to cover 24/7 serviceAdditional InformationLocation:Offutt AFB, NEOn-site/Hybrid/Remote: HybridTravel:10%
